The Ratings Associate will work with lead analysts in assigning and monitoring credit ratings; researching, drafting, and publishing research; and other activities. The Ratings Associate will perform an evaluation of credit risk by integrating credit risk inputs prepared by internal and external parties. In conducting credit analysis for their assigned credits, transactions, or credit reviews. The Ratings Associate is expected to participate in rating committee discussions and interact with issuers and other market participants, in collaboration with lead analysts.
The Ratings Associate role is integral to Moody’s focus on ratings accuracy, research, and market outreach. The Ratings Associate role will typically focus primarily on one rating group, with the potential for cross-training in and/or work for other rating groups.
For US-based roles only: the anticipated hiring base salary range for this position is $76,100.00 - $82,500, depending on factors such as experience, education, level, skills, and location. This range is based on a full-time position. In addition to base salary, this role is eligible for incentive compensation.
